Mount Bolivar

Mount Bolivar is a peak in , and has an elevation of 4,337 feet.
Tap on a place
to explore it
  • Type: Peak with an elevation of 4,337 feet
  • Description: mountain in Oregon, United States of America
  • Also known as: Mount Biliver”, “Mount Boliver”, and “Mt. Bolivar
